EXCEEDS logo
Exceeds
tomasAscencio

PROFILE

Tomasascencio

Tomas Ascencio contributed to openMF/fineract by enhancing the Run Reports API, introducing a centralized ReportParameters class to standardize and document API parameters. He refactored the RunreportsApiResource to align with this new model, improving maintainability and clarity for API consumers. Using Java, OpenAPI, and Spring Boot, Tomas addressed an OpenAPI exposure gap for required GET parameters, which improved integration reliability and developer onboarding. In openMF/web-app, he focused on front end internationalization, delivering a targeted fix for Spanish translation accuracy. His work demonstrated depth in both backend API design and user-facing localization, addressing specific integration and usability challenges.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

2Total
Bugs
1
Commits
2
Features
1
Lines of code
285
Activity Months2

Work History

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025 focused on Run Reports API enhancements in openMF/fineract. Delivered OpenAPI improvements and parameter centralization to improve API clarity and client onboarding. Implemented a new ReportParameters class to standardize and document Run Reports API parameters, and refined RunreportsApiResource usage to align with the new model. Fixed an OpenAPI exposure gap for required GET parameters (FINERACT-2353), improving API discoverability and integration reliability.

July 2025

1 Commits

Jul 1, 2025

July 2025 performance snapshot for openMF/web-app: No new features released this month; primary focus on quality and stability, specifically localization accuracy. Completed a targeted bug fix to correct Spanish translations to ensure accuracy and consistency for Spanish-speaking users, mitigating user confusion and support inquiries. The fix was implemented as a single targeted commit (WEB-264) and merged with minimal risk to the localization pipeline. Commit: 88305daade37098ed0dc6028a5117b09ea4fd656.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ture70.0%
Performance60.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aJavaScript

Technical Skills

API DevelopmentFront End DevelopmentInternationalizationJavaOpenAPIRESTful ServicesSpring Boot

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

openMF/web-app

Jul 2025 Jul 2025
1 Month active

Languages Used

JavaScript

Technical Skills

Front End DevelopmentInternationalization

openMF/fineract

Sep 2025 Sep 2025
1 Month active

Languages Used

Java

Technical Skills

API DevelopmentJavaOpenAPIRESTful ServicesSpring Boot

Generated by Exceeds AIThis report is designed for sharing and indexing